Output 5f80493d3fc9d16153f66adc23e36cf414cd00ae2cd0a9bc02b2a0ad7f84530c:1

value
1083679
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d148f8c64a78821ba8d778e61708372ff0dd90e OP_EQUAL
address
3EYyqBD6587U3WozEfVSDmxcCEEXHdN5qv
transaction
5f80493d3fc9d16153f66adc23e36cf414cd00ae2cd0a9bc02b2a0ad7f84530c
confirmations
388525
spent
true